HR2132 is a resolution adopted by the Texas House of Representatives that congratulates the 2018 Texas State Artist honorees. This resolution recognizes outstanding individuals in the arts who have made significant contributions to the cultural landscape of Texas. The honorees include the State Poet Laureate, State Musician, State Two-Dimensional Artist, and State Three-Dimensional Artist, each distinguished in their respective fields. Their accomplishments and influence are highlighted as exemplary representations of Texas's diverse artistic community.
